A point `A` is located at a distance `r = 1.5 m` from a point source of sound of frequency `600 H_(Z)`. The power of the source is `0.8 W`. Speed of sound in air is `340 m//s` and density of air is `1.29 kg//m^(3)`. Find at the point `A`, (a) the pressure oscillation amplitude`(Deltap)_(m)` (b) the displacement oscillation amplitude `A`.

A

`10Nm^(-2)`

B

`15 Nm^(-2)`

C

`20 Nm^(-2)`

D

`5Nm^(-2)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
D

`I=(P_(0)^(2))/(2rhoV)=P/(4pir^(2))=(P_(0)^(2))/(2rhoV)` where `P_(1) P_(0), V` are power, pressure amplitude and velocity respectively `rArr P_(0)=sqrt((PrhoV)/(2pir^(2)))=sqrt((50pixx1xx330)/(2pixx330))=5`
